Kingston

Kingston, the county seat, is a vibrant and eclectic city with a rich history and culture. Its historic downtown area is filled with charming shops, restaurants, and galleries, while its waterfront area offers stunning views of the Hudson River. With its excellent schools and convenient commute access to NYC, Kingston is an attractive option for families and professionals alike.

The NYC Commute Reality

One of the biggest advantages of living in Ulster County is its convenient commute access to NYC. The Trailways bus from Kingston to Midtown Manhattan takes approximately 2 hours, making it an attractive option for commuters. However, it's essential to consider the pros and cons of the commute, including the cost, frequency, and reliability of the service.

While the commute can be long, it's also a great opportunity to relax, read, or work on the way to or from the city. Many residents also appreciate the flexibility of being able to escape the city on weekends and enjoy the peace and tranquility of the Hudson Valley.
